摘要
Cryogenic mechanical milling successfully converted a-phase poly(vinylidene fluoride) (PVDF) powder into beta-phase PVDF, as measured by wide-angle X-ray diffraction. The presence of beta-phase PVDF became more pronounced with increased milling times over the limited time range evaluated. This was the first recorded instance of beta-phase powders forming from the alpha phase through milling. These beta-phase powders maintained their crystal structure during compression molding at 70 degreesC. (C) 2003 Wiley Periodicals, Inc. J Polym Sci Part B: Polym Phys 42: 91-97, 2004.
